← HistoryWhich consequence emerged as medieval Islamic engineers scaled up water clock designs using algebraic principles?
A)Increased accuracy in timekeeping
B)Difficulty in maintaining constant flow✓
C)Simplified gear train construction
D)Reduced metal casting imperfections
💡 Explanation
Larger Islamic water clocks suffered flow variations because maintaining precise water level control and equal flow rates became significantly more difficult as tank dimensions increased, therefore leading to diminished accuracy rather than improved accuracy otherwise attainable with theoretical algebraic calibrations in steady-state simulations.
